According to Incident Command, the fire was initially reported at approximately 5 acres, running uphill in light fuels with a moderate rate of spread. No structures were threatened. The fire later grew to approximately 15 acres, prompting a second alarm response. An aerial assessment from helicopters later reported the fire at 5–10 acres, creeping in light fuels with minimal fire activity. Three helicopters were initially assigned to the incident, but two of the additional aircraft were subsequently canceled. UPDATE: Incident Command has canceled the second alarm as firefighters continue to make progress on the incident. No structures remain threatened. UPDATE 2: The fire is holding at the ridge at approximately 10–15 acres, and crews are making good progress, according to Incident Command. The second alarm has been canceled, and firefighters remain on scene continuing suppression and containment efforts.
